Abstract
Methods, systems, and devices for broadcast transmissions in wireless communication are described. A base station may transmit a control reference signal (CRS), a UE-specific reference signal (UERS), and broadcast data (e.g., broadcast physical downlink shared channel (PDSCH) data) in a broadcast downlink transmission. A UE may identify that the CRS and UERS are associated with the broadcast downlink data, and demodulate the broadcast downlink data in the broadcast downlink transmission based at least in part on the CRS and UERS. A UE may estimate a frequency offset based on a phase difference between the CRS and UERS, combine the CRS and UERS for use in a channel estimation, and demodulate the broadcast data based at least in part on the estimated frequency offset and channel estimation. The base station may provide signaling, such as dynamic or semi-static signaling, that indicates presence of both CRS and UERS.

11. A method of wireless communication comprising:
-
identifying a plurality of receivers that are to receive a broadcast downlink (DL) transmission; formatting a DL grant for the broadcast DL transmission, wherein the DL grant is associated with a control reference signal (CRS); formatting broadcast data, the CRS, and a user equipment (UE) specific reference signal (UERS) in the broadcast DL transmission, wherein a transmission type of the broadcast data is associated with both the CRS and the UERS; transmitting the DL grant to the plurality of receivers; and transmitting the broadcast DL transmission to the plurality of receivers. - View Dependent Claims (12, 13, 14, 15, 16)
